Notice: The Lahore High Court Friday issued notices to federal and Punjab governments on a plea seeking stoppage of President and Prime Minister’s salaries until provision of jobs to the visually impaired. The petitioner said there were 4,000 vacancies lying vacant in Punjab and 3,500 in federal government. —Correspondent
